The Right Coast

October 13, 2003
By Tom Smith

Glen, Glen. You tell us about the "highly photogenic" new Joan of Arc in Paris, braving the commies, the whiners and the America haters, and don't give us a link to a photo? Well, here. (Picture takes a minute to load for some reason; try scrolling up and down a few times.) Libertarians in love.